Weight Limits, Age Recommendations, and Safe Jumping Practices
- Published Weight Capacities 10 FT models support 330 pounds, 12 FT models handle 400 pounds, and 14 FT versions accommodate 450 pounds. These represent maximum safe loads rather than suggested targets.
- Single Jumper Recommendation While weight capacities accommodate multiple users physically, safety organizations recommend single jumpers to prevent mid-air collisions and landing injuries.
- Age Appropriateness Children under 6 should use trampolines only under direct adult supervision with restricted bounce heights. Older children can use equipment more independently with established safety rules.
- Adult Supervision Requirements Regardless of child age, an adult should maintain visual contact during use to intervene if dangerous behaviors develop or equipment issues appear.
- Prohibited Activities Somersaults, flips, and other acrobatic maneuvers create injury risks that residential trampolines are not designed to mitigate regardless of user skill level.
- Entry and Exit Procedures Use the included ladder for access rather than climbing over safety nets or springs. Exit by ladder or controlled stepping rather than jumping off the unit.

Selecting the Right Sports & Fitness Trampoline Size
Trampoline sizing involves balancing yard space, intended users, and budget considerations against each other. The 14 FT model provides the most versatile jumping experience but requires substantial yard real estate — approximately 20 feet of cleared space in diameter when accounting for recommended safety clearances. Families with larger properties and multiple children typically find this investment worthwhile for the enhanced experience.
The 12 FT option represents the practical middle ground for typical suburban yards. Most residential properties can accommodate the required footprint while still maintaining surrounding lawn space for other activities. The weight capacity remains adequate for adult use, making this size appropriate for mixed-age families where parents participate alongside children.
Compact 10 FT models serve smaller yards, younger user populations, and entry-level budgets without sacrificing safety fundamentals. Families uncertain about long-term trampoline interest often start here before upgrading, while properties with space constraints find this size the only viable option. The weight capacity suits children and lighter adults comfortably for typical recreational use.
Beyond size, consider specific model features when comparing apparently similar options. Ladder inclusion saves separate purchases, enclosure net specifications vary between product lines, and spring pad thickness affects both safety and longevity. Reading complete specifications rather than just diameter and price ensures the selected model matches actual requirements.

Seasonal Care and Long-Term Equipment Protection
Year-round outdoor placement requires seasonal attention to maintain equipment in optimal condition. Spring inspections should verify that winter weather has not loosened connections, damaged padding, or stretched springs beyond acceptable tolerances. Clean accumulated debris from the jumping surface and net enclosure before heavy use seasons begin. Check for any rust development at connection points that might indicate galvanization wear requiring attention.
Summer maintenance focuses on UV exposure management despite resistant material specifications. Periodic cleaning removes pollen, bird droppings, and environmental residue that can accelerate material degradation when left in place. Inspect padding monthly for compression loss or surface cracks that indicate replacement needs. Verify net tension remains adequate to prevent dangerous sagging in entry zones.
Winter preparation depends on regional climate severity. In mild areas, equipment can remain assembled year-round with monthly inspections continuing through cooler months. Harsh winter regions benefit from net and pad removal to prevent ice loading that could stress components. Some owners in extreme climates disassemble completely for garage storage, though this requires spring reinstallation labor. Regardless of approach, ensure standing water cannot pool on surfaces where freeze cycles could cause damage.
